Method

Preparation

1

Rinse the Rice

Rinse the basmati rice under cold water until the water runs clear. Soak it in water for 30 minutes, then drain.

2

Prepare the Vegetables

Dice the carrot, bell pepper, potato, and slice the onion thinly. Set aside.

Cooking

3

Sauté the Onions

In a large pot, heat the cooking oil (or ghee) over medium heat. Add the sliced onions and sauté until golden brown.

4

Add Ginger-Garlic Paste

Add the ginger-garlic paste to the pot and sauté for another 2 minutes until fragrant.

5

Cook the Vegetables

Stir in the diced carrots, potatoes, bell pepper, and green peas. Cook for 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are slightly tender.

6

Add Spices

Sprinkle in the cumin seeds, turmeric powder, coriander powder, biryani masala, salt, and black pepper. Mix well to combine.

7

Add Water and Rice

Pour the water into the pot and bring it to a boil. Once boiling, add the soaked and drained basmati rice, gently stirring to combine.

8

Simmer the Biryani

Reduce the heat to low, cover the pot with a tight-fitting lid, and let it simmer for 20 minutes or until the rice is cooked and all the water is absorbed.

Serving

9

Fluff and Garnish

Once cooked, turn off the heat and let the biryani sit covered for an additional 5 minutes. Fluff the rice with a fork, then garnish with chopped cilantro and fried onions before serving.

10

Serve

Serve the vegetable biryani hot, ideally with a side of raita or salad.
